THE Evening Times' role in exposing the justice system's failure to inform a Glasgow family of the release of their father's killer has been raised in the Scottish Parliament.
Pollok MSP Johann Lamont asked Deputy Justice Minister Hugh Henry if he was aware that, despite promises to the family of James Mitchell, they had been badly let down.See the full content of this document
